My design space: An old lima bean factory

There aren’t many design studios that can claim a 125-year-old former lima bean factory as their headquarters, but for California-based Mattson Creative, it’s home. Featuring a huge corrugated metal exterior, the studio cuts an impressive silhouette – but inside there’s an even more unusual vibe.

“I’d call it mid-century modern meets vintage industrial,” says designer Ty Mattson, who counts Apple, DreamWorks and Billabong among his clients. “We have lots of exposed beams and woodwork, and lots of the original gears and contraptions that were used to process the lima beans are intact.”
